Windows Server 2008 R2 IIS服务配置与管理
发布时间: 2023-12-19 08:56:18 阅读量: 63 订阅数: 34
# 1. 简介
## 1.1 什么是IIS服务
## 1.2 Windows Server 2008 R2中的IIS服务
## 1.3 为什么IIS服务在服务器中的重要性
### 2. 安装和配置IIS服务
在本章中,我们将介绍如何在Windows Server 2008 R2上安装和配置IIS服务,以便于部署Web应用程序和提供网络服务。首先我们会讨论安装IIS服务的步骤,然后会介绍IIS服务的基本配置和设置网站及应用程序池。
#### 2.1 安装IIS服务的步骤
要在Windows Server 2008 R2上安装IIS服务,您可以按照以下步骤进行操作:
1. 打开服务器管理器。
2. 在服务器管理器中,单击“角色”节点,然后在右侧窗格中选择“添加角色”。
3. 在“添加角色向导”中,选择“Web 服务器(IIS)”角色,并按照指引完成安装过程。
4. 在安装完成后,可以通过“控制面板” > “程序” > “启用或关闭Windows功能”来对IIS服务进行进一步的配置。
#### 2.2 IIS服务的基本配置
安装完成后,您可以按照以下步骤进行基本配置:
1. 打开IIS 管理器。
2. 在左侧窗格中,展开服务器节点,然后展开“网站”节点。
3. 右键单击“默认网站”,选择“编辑绑定”,配置网站的端口和主机头(如果有多个网站)。
4. 可以在“应用程序池”处为网站选择或创建新的应用程序池,并配置应用程序池的属性和.NET Framework 版本。
#### 2.3 网站和应用程序池的设置
在IIS 管理器中,您可以对网站和应用程序池进行详细的设置,包括但不限于:
- 管理网站的目录和文件权限;
- 配置网站的HTTPS 访问和证书;
- 设置应用程序池的身份验证方式和进程模型;
- 调整应用程序池的资源限制和回收策略。
通过以上步骤,您可以在Windows Server 2008 R2上完成IIS服务的安装和基本配置,为后续的Web应用程序部署和网络服务提供基础支持。
## 3. 管理IIS服务
在本节中,我们将讨论如何管理IIS服务,包括图形化界面和命令行工具的使用,以及如何监控IIS服务的性能和健康状况。
### 3.1 管理IIS的图形化界面
要管理IIS服务,可以通过图形化界面使用IIS Manager工具。下面是一些常见的管理任务和对应的操作步骤:
- **创建新网站**:在IIS Manager中,右键单击“Sites”,选择“Add Website”,然后按照向导的步骤进行设置。
- **配置应用程序池**:在IIS Manager中,选择“Application Pools”,然后选择应用程序池,右键单击选择“Advanced Settings”进行配置。
- **设置绑定和SSL**:在IIS Manager中,选择网站,右键单击选择“Edit Bindings”,然后可以配置网站的绑定和SSL证书。
### 3.2 使用命令行工具管理IIS
除了图形化界面,还可以使用命令行工具来管理IIS服务。以下是一些常用的命仇行操作:
- **创建新网站**:可以使用`appcmd`命令来创建新的网站,例如:
```bash
appcmd add site /name:Example /bindings:http/*:80: /physicalPath:C:\Example
```
- **启动或停止网站**:可以使用`appcmd`命令来启动或停止指定的网站,例如:
```bash
appcmd start site /site.name:Example
```
- **查看应用程序池信息**:可以使用`appcmd`命令来查看应用程序池的信息,例如:
```
```
0
0